1993 Ford Mondeo vs. 1993 Buick Park Avenue

To start off, both 1993 Ford Mondeo and 1993 Buick Park Avenue were released in the same year (1993).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 3,791 cc (6 cylinders), 1993 Buick Park Avenue is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1993 Buick Park Avenue (205 HP) has 91 more horse power than 1993 Ford Mondeo. (114 HP) In normal driving conditions, 1993 Buick Park Avenue should accelerate faster than 1993 Ford Mondeo.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1993 Buick Park Avenue weights approximately 560 kg more than 1993 Ford Mondeo.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1993 Buick Park Avenue (260 Nm) has 108 more torque (in Nm) than 1993 Ford Mondeo. (152 Nm). This means 1993 Buick Park Avenue will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1993 Ford Mondeo. 1993 Buick Park Avenue has automatic transmission and 1993 Ford Mondeo has manual transmission. 1993 Ford Mondeo will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 1993 Buick Park Avenue will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.

Compare all specifications:

1993 Ford Mondeo 1993 Buick Park Avenue
Make Ford Buick
Model Mondeo Park Avenue
Year Released 1993 1993
Body Type Station Wagon Sedan
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1796 cc 3791 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Horse Power 114 HP 205 HP
Torque 152 Nm 260 Nm
Engine Bore Size 80.7 mm 96.5 mm
Engine Stroke Size 88 mm 86.4 mm
Drive Type Front Front
Transmission Type Manual Automatic
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 5 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 1090 kg 1650 kg
Vehicle Length 4640 mm 5220 mm
Vehicle Width 1730 mm 1880 mm
Vehicle Height 1400 mm 1410 mm
Wheelbase Size 2770 mm 2820 mm
